The basic idea of npm is that marketoriented management of the public sector will lead to greater costefficiency for governments, without having negative sideeffects on other objectives and considerations. New public management npm is a management culture that emphasizes the centrality of the customer, as well as accountability for results npm, compared to other public management theories, is more oriented towards outcomes and efficiency through better management of public budget. Emergency management protects communities by coordinating and integrating all activities necessary to build, sustain, and improve the capability to mitigate against, prepare for, respond to, and recover from threatened or actual natural disasters, acts of terrorism, or other manmade disasters.
